Analysis & Insight
Average spend up as pubs and bars grow share
Latest data from Lumina Intelligence’s Eating & Drinking Out Panel indicates a shift in channel share during the four weeks to 11 July 2021 driven by the Euros. As consumers gathered to watch the football, pubs and bars have continued to gain channel share, accounting for 15.0% of total eating out occasions across the four weeks – up 2ppts versus the previous period. Restaurants have also continued to grow share, up 0.6ppts to 12.7%.
